@AbiDashery  I just clicked onto "Customer Service Stats" (Left Column in Shop Mgr.), which is really Star Seller Metrics. On that page, it says:
"These stats are refreshed every 24 hours. On the first of every month, we’ll check if you’ve earned any Star Seller badges and show you an overview of your service at the top of this page based on these stats from the past three months".

@HauteVintageJewels: This is an on going issue that has been reported numerous times recently in this forum where some orders "lose" their processing time. There is a November 2022 response ("solution") from an Etsy Admin to this issue at https://community.etsy.com/t5/Technical-Issues/Missed-star-seller-due-to-apparently-missing-processi...

Based on other posts in this forum, the ability to have this corrected by support seems to be rather hit or miss depending on who you get.

It has been suggested to not mention Star Seller when contacting support so your inquiry is not summarily brushed aside, but instead to keep the conversation solely on the missing processing time.
